Overview
BZX8850-B2V7YL from Nexperia is a low-current Zener diode in SOD882 (DFN1006-2) package, designed for precision voltage regulation at 2.7 V nominal with ±2 % tolerance. It delivers stable reference voltage at 50 μA test current, features 250 mW total power dissipation, and exhibits 190 pF capacitance at 0 V reverse bias-ideal for low-power sensor biasing and portable battery-powered voltage clamping.

Technical Context
This Zener operates in reverse breakdown mode with a nominal working voltage of 2.7 V at IZ = 50 μA, exhibiting a temperature coefficient of −3.5 mV/K and differential resistance ≤600 Ω at 5 mA. Its ultra-low leakage (≤1.0 μA at VR = 2.0 V) supports stable biasing in high-impedance analog circuits.
The device uses silicon planar technology in a leadless DFN1006-2 package with 1.0 × 0.6 × 0.5 mm body dimensions and cathode-indicating top-side marking bar. Thermal resistance from junction to ambient is 500 K/W on FR4 PCB with single-sided copper.
Key Specifications
| Parameter | Value and Actual Design Meaning |
|---|---|
| Nominal Zener Voltage | 2.7 V at IZ = 50 μA - precise low-voltage reference for microcontroller reset circuits and sensor supply rails |
| Tolerance | ±2 % - enables tight regulation without post-production trimming in production-grade designs |
| Power Dissipation | 250 mW at Tamb ≤ 25 °C - sufficient for continuous operation in handheld and IoT endpoint applications |
| Diode Capacitance | 190 pF at VR = 0 V, f = 1 MHz - minimizes signal coupling in high-frequency bias networks |
| Forward Voltage | 0.9 V at IF = 10 mA - ensures predictable conduction during forward-biased protection scenarios |
| Junction Temperature | 150 °C maximum - supports reliable operation in industrial ambient environments up to +125 °C |
| Reverse Leakage | ≤1.0 μA at VR = 2.0 V - preserves battery life in always-on monitoring circuits |

FAQ
What is the maximum reverse voltage before breakdown for BZX8850-B2V7YL?
The nominal Zener voltage is 2.7 V at 50 μA test current, with guaranteed minimum 2.65 V and maximum 2.75 V under those conditions. Breakdown begins gradually above ~2.4 V; full regulation occurs between 2.65 V and 2.75 V. Absolute maximum reverse voltage is not specified-operation beyond 2.75 V increases power dissipation and temperature rise nonlinearly.
Can BZX8850-B2V7YL be used in forward conduction mode?
Yes-it functions as a standard silicon diode with 0.9 V forward voltage at 10 mA. However, its primary design purpose is reverse-bias Zener regulation. Forward conduction is only recommended for protection clamping or polarity detection, not as a rectifier, due to its low 200 mA absolute maximum forward current rating.
How does the ±2 % tolerance affect circuit accuracy in a 3.3 V supply rail monitor?
At 2.7 V nominal, ±2 % tolerance means the actual Zener voltage falls between 2.646 V and 2.754 V. When used in a resistor-divider monitor for a 3.3 V rail, this translates to ±0.4 % uncertainty in the trip point-well within typical reset IC hysteresis windows and sufficient for detecting 5 % supply droop (3.135 V).
Is thermal derating required when operating at 85 °C ambient temperature?
Yes. With Rth(j-a) = 500 K/W and Tj(max) = 150 °C, the allowable power dissipation at 85 °C ambient drops to (150 − 85) / 500 = 130 mW. Designers must limit average Zener current to ≤48 mA at 2.7 V to stay within thermal limits, versus the full 250 mW rating at 25 °C.
